Mackenzie Announces Local Share Account Grant for Emmaus Borough

June 14, 2022

HARRISBURG – Rep. Milou Mackenzie (R-Lehigh/Montgomery/Northampton) announced the awarding of $25,458 in state funding for the reconstruction of South Second Street in Emmaus Borough.

“I’m happy I was able to advocate on behalf of Emmaus Borough for this grant,” said Mackenzie. “This project will go a long way toward improving public safety in the borough.”

The grant was approved last week by the Commonwealth Financing Authority, which was established as an independent agency that holds fiduciary responsibility over the funding of programs and investments in Pennsylvania’s economic growth.

Local Share Account grants are funded through local gaming revenue, not taxpayer dollars.
